Modern high-frequency sonar transducers represent a significant advancement in fishing technology, particularly valuable for anglers working Britain's diverse waterways—from Scottish lochs and Welsh reservoirs to English rivers and coastal inshore zones. These sophisticated devices utilise advanced frequency bands to produce exceptionally clear imaging of underwater structures, vegetation beds, and fish behaviour in shallow water environments. What distinguishes high-frequency technology is its ability to generate detailed, almost photographic clarity of the seabed and surrounding water column, enabling British anglers to identify productive fishing zones with unprecedented precision. Unlike conventional sonar systems, high-frequency transducers excel at detecting subtle variations in bottom composition—crucial information when fishing rocky outcrops, gravel bars, weed-fringed margins, or the transition zones where fish typically congregate. The British angling market has increasingly embraced this technology, recognising that advanced imaging dramatically improves catch success rates whilst reducing time spent casting into unproductive water. Contemporary high-frequency systems offer multiple viewing angles including downward imaging, side-scan capability, and increasingly, full 360-degree coverage. For small boat operators and shore anglers utilising portable systems, these transducers provide genuine competitive advantage. Key considerations for UK buyers include transducer mounting compatibility with existing electronics, integration capabilities with major chartplotter brands prevalent in British waters, performance reliability in varying salinity levels (particularly important for coastal fishing), and practical aspects such as power requirements and cable durability. Understanding High-Frequency Sonar Technology

High-frequency sonar operates at elevated frequency bands, typically ranging from 455 kHz through to ultra-high-definition frequencies exceeding 1000 kHz. These frequencies enable superior resolution compared to traditional sonar, producing imagery that resembles underwater photographs rather than abstract sonar returns. Higher frequencies provide narrower beam angles, delivering more concentrated coverage of smaller areas—ideal for precise structure identification. For British anglers, understanding frequency performance across varying water conditions proves essential. Freshwater systems frequently exhibit different acoustic properties than coastal salt water, influencing transducer performance characteristics. Premium modern systems compensate for these variations through adaptive technology and frequency-switching capabilities.
